Lagarde speech: Inflation is projected to remain too high for too long

While testifying before European Parliament's Committee on Economic and Monetary Affairs, European Central Bank (ECB) President Christine Lagarde said that inflation is projected to remain too high for too long, per Reuters.

Lagarde reiterated that wage pressures have strengthened on the back of robust labour markets and added that employees are aiming to recoup some of the purchasing power. "The key ECB interest rates remain our primary tool for setting the monetary policy stance," she concluded.

Market reaction

EUR/USD keeps its footing following these comments and was last seen gaining 0.5% on the day at 1.0720.
